This patch adds dt binding for Xilinx DSI-TX subsystem.
The Xilinx MIPI DSI (Display serial interface) Transmitter Subsystem implements the Mobile Industry Processor Interface (MIPI) based display interface. It supports the interface with the programmable logic (FPGA).
